Hard problems in max-algebra, control theory, hypergraphs and other areas
We introduce the max-atom problem (MAP): solving (in Z) systems of inequations of the form max(x, y)+k z, where x, y, z are variables and k ∈ Z. Our initial motivation for MAP was reasoning on delays in circuits using SAT Modulo Theories [10], viewing MAP as a natural extension of Difference Logic, i.e., inequations of the form x+ k y. متن کاملMax-Plus Algebra and Applications to System Theory and Optimal Control
In the modeling of human activities, in contrast to natural phenomena, quite frequently only the operations max (or min) and + are needed. A typical example is the performance evaluation of synchronized processes such as those encountered in manufacturing (dynamic systems made up of storage and queuing networks). متن کاملMax-Plus algebra on tensors and its properties
In this paper we generalize the max plus algebra system of real matrices to the class of real tensors and derive its fundamental properties. Also we give some basic properties for the left (right) inverse, under the new system. The existence of order 2 left (right) inverses of tensors is characterized.
